ALEXANDRIA, Va., April 9 -- United States Patent no. 12,272,994, issued on April 8, was assigned to DENSO Corp. (Kariya, Japan).
"Rotating electrical machine" was invented by Yuki Takahashi (Kariya, Japan).
According to the abstract* released by the U.S. Patent & Trademark Office: "In a rotating electrical machine, each magnet installation hole is formed to be in conformity with a radial cross-sectional shape of a corresponding magnet to be installed therein. Each of the magnets and the corresponding magnet installation holes has opposite peripheral surfaces.
